The ammeter on our Rival 41 has turned up its toes. It seems to be a Perkins/VDO instrument of a size which is no longer current (no pun intended). Contemporary models seem to be around 2" diameter whereas the one I wish to replace is around 2.5" diameter.

I'm after a +- 50amp for preference, but I guess +- 30 would do the job. Anyone know of a source for something like that?
 
You can get a 'converter ring' so you can use a 2" gauge in the original 2½" hole from VDO. I did this a couple of years ago when I replaced an old VDO gauge.
